Fill in the blanks with the words in the list: raise, rear, fees, illiterate, overcrowded, priority, financial support

Fill in the blanks with the words in the list: raise, rear, fees, illiterate, overcrowded, priority, financial support

1. My grandma has never been to school.She is __________________________.She can neither read nor write.
2. It is somewhat difficult for a working woman to ________________________________her children properly.
3. Most poor countries benefit from ___________________________________provided by the richest nations.
4____________________________________________classes are regarded as an obstacle to quality education.
5. Birth control campaigns ______________________peoples awareness to the necessity of spacing out pregnancies.
6. School __________________________in private schools have recently become too high for parents to bear.
7. Reducing illiteracy is given top __________________________after the Sahara issue by the present government
